    CLIP DESCRIPTION:
    D'Artagnan (Gabriel Byrne) begs Louis (Leonardo DiCaprio) to have mercy on Phillipe (Leonardo DiCaprio), but he orders him back to the mask since Phillipe says that is what he despises most.
    FILM DESCRIPTION:
    This low-budget adaptation of Alexandre Dumas's classic novel was in direct competition with the lavish MGM production. It follows the story of the future king of France who is put into an iron mask while his younger twin is placed on the throne.

    Why do you think Louis said that their mother's love had meant nothing to either of them? Because Louis was selfish and spoiled rotten, and because he thought Philippe would only have hatred for their mother on account of his imprisonment?

    • @jw1731
      @jw1731 Год назад +2

      that's a good and thought-provoking question.
      I think Louis is the sort of psychopath that actually understands the idea of empathy and the pain endured by others, but he's just so self-serving it becomes irrelevant. He knows that Phillipe has a right to be upset at their mother for being complicit in his imprisonment and torture, even though he himself was the perpetrator of it. So for a brief moment he uses Phillippe's grievance as ammunition to roast his mother; but when Phillipe acts like a bigger and more benevolent person than he is, ashamed and frustrated knowing that his attack on his mother's character was thwarted, he assaults Phillippe.
      As to why Louis would have the nerve to criticize his mother for not standing up to an atrocity he himself was responsible for, I'd say it's a typical case of cognitive dissonance. In order to discredit someone in a moment, he doesn't realize or care if it becomes a self-own. Of course, he's the king and doesn't have to make sense; it's only those under him who would suffer for his mistake, like the minister who was executed for distributing rotten food like Louis ordered.
      Another possibility is: Phillippe does harbor some resentment toward his mother for her complicity, or maybe after a few years as being pampered and fawned over as the king he'll become spoiled enough to come around and hate her for that. See, in that moment he needed all the allies he could get, and by behaving cartoonishly honorable he would further win his mother and D'artagnan over. Being imprisoned and tormented for years, Phillippe must've accumulated the endurance for suffering and learned how to be obsequious and non-threatening so as to survive. So even if he resented his mother in that moment, the last thing he would do is show it. In fact, his request to be put to death instead of being locked away in his mask may very well have been reverse psychology to get Louis to keep him alive, because then there's a chance the three musketeers could rescue him. But ultimately, despite his scheming nature, he still has a honorable and gentle nature which Louis does not.
